Applications should only use zlib.h. 9275793eaSopenharmony_ci */ 10275793eaSopenharmony_ci 11275793eaSopenharmony_ci/* Structure for decoding tables. Each entry provides either the 12275793eaSopenharmony_ci information needed to do the operation requested by the code that 13275793eaSopenharmony_ci indexed that table entry, or it provides a pointer to another 14275793eaSopenharmony_ci table that indexes more bits of the code. op indicates whether 15275793eaSopenharmony_ci the entry is a pointer to another table, a literal, a length or 16275793eaSopenharmony_ci distance, an end-of-block, or an invalid code. For a table 17275793eaSopenharmony_ci pointer, the low four bits of op is the number of index bits of 18275793eaSopenharmony_ci that table. For a length or distance, the low four bits of op 19275793eaSopenharmony_ci is the number of extra bits to get after the code. bits is 20275793eaSopenharmony_ci the number of bits in this code or part of the code to drop off 21275793eaSopenharmony_ci of the bit buffer. val is the actual byte to output in the case 22275793eaSopenharmony_ci of a literal, the base length or distance, or the offset from 23275793eaSopenharmony_ci the current table to the next table. Each entry is four bytes. */ 24275793eaSopenharmony_citypedef struct { 25275793eaSopenharmony_ci unsigned char op; /* operation, extra bits, table bits */ 26275793eaSopenharmony_ci unsigned char bits; /* bits in this part of the code */ 27275793eaSopenharmony_ci unsigned short val; /* offset in table or code value */ 28275793eaSopenharmony_ci} code; 29275793eaSopenharmony_ci 30275793eaSopenharmony_ci/* op values as set by inflate_table(): 31275793eaSopenharmony_ci 00000000 - literal 32275793eaSopenharmony_ci 0000tttt - table link, tttt != 0 is the number of table index bits 33275793eaSopenharmony_ci 0001eeee - length or distance, eeee is the number of extra bits 34275793eaSopenharmony_ci 01100000 - end of block 35275793eaSopenharmony_ci 01000000 - invalid code 36275793eaSopenharmony_ci */ 37275793eaSopenharmony_ci 38275793eaSopenharmony_ci/* Maximum size of the dynamic table. The maximum number of code structures is 39275793eaSopenharmony_ci 1444, which is the sum of 852 for literal/length codes and 592 for distance 40275793eaSopenharmony_ci codes. These values were found by exhaustive searches using the program 41275793eaSopenharmony_ci examples/enough.c found in the zlib distribution. The arguments to that 42275793eaSopenharmony_ci program are the number of symbols, the initial root table size, and the 43275793eaSopenharmony_ci maximum bit length of a code. "enough 286 9 15" for literal/length codes 44275793eaSopenharmony_ci returns 852, and "enough 30 6 15" for distance codes returns 592. The 45275793eaSopenharmony_ci initial root table size (9 or 6) is found in the fifth argument of the 46275793eaSopenharmony_ci inflate_table() calls in inflate.c and infback.c. If the root table size is 47275793eaSopenharmony_ci changed, then these maximum sizes would be need to be recalculated and 48275793eaSopenharmony_ci updated. */ 49275793eaSopenharmony_ci#define ENOUGH_LENS 852 50275793eaSopenharmony_ci#define ENOUGH_DISTS 592 51275793eaSopenharmony_ci#define ENOUGH (ENOUGH_LENS+ENOUGH_DISTS) 52275793eaSopenharmony_ci 53275793eaSopenharmony_ci/* Type of code to build for inflate_table() */ 54275793eaSopenharmony_citypedef enum { 55275793eaSopenharmony_ci CODES, 56275793eaSopenharmony_ci LENS, 57275793eaSopenharmony_ci DISTS 58275793eaSopenharmony_ci} codetype; 59275793eaSopenharmony_ci 60275793eaSopenharmony_ciint ZLIB_INTERNAL inflate_table(codetype type, unsigned short FAR *lens, 61275793eaSopenharmony_ci unsigned codes, code FAR * FAR *table, 62275793eaSopenharmony_ci unsigned FAR *bits, unsigned short FAR *work); 63
